The 3rd Place Play-off of the ICC Women’s T20 World Cup East Asia Pacific Qualifier 2025 features Indonesia Women (INA-W) vs Japan Women (JAP-W) on 15 September 2025 at Albert Park Ground 2, Suva, Fiji.
